Protecting Your Apache Web Server

When deploying an Apache web server, establishing robust security measures is paramount. A well-configured server can withstand common threats and mitigate the risk of vulnerabilities being exploited. Begin by patching your Apache software to the latest apache server support version, as this often includes crucial security corrections. Subsequently, disable any unnecessary modules or features that could potentially create exploitable points. Implement strict access control policies, employing firewalls and authentication mechanisms to restrict user access to sensitive resources. Regularly monitor your server logs for suspicious activity and conduct penetration tests to identify potential vulnerabilities. By following these best practices, you can significantly strengthen the security posture of your Apache web server.

Frequent Apache Errors and Solutions

Apache, the widely utilized web server, can sometimes encounter errors that hinder website functionality. Addressing these issues promptly is crucial for maintaining a smooth user experience. This article delves into some frequent Apache errors and provides potential solutions to get your site back on track.

One prevalent error is the "404 Not Found" status. This typically occurs when a user requests a webpage that doesn't exist on the server. Confirm the URL for accuracy and ensure the requested file or directory is present in your website's primary folder.

Another common issue is the "500 Internal Server Error". This more generic error suggests a problem within the Apache server itself. Review the server's error logs for detailed information about the cause of the error. It could be related to PHP scripts, access rights, or configuration settings.
